While today is a fun run and a fabulous opportunity to raise money for charity, it is important that entrants don’t push themselves too hard and keep hydrated along the way.
There will be an emergency buffer lane along the Gateway Bridge and Kingsford Smith Drive where medical staff will be patrolling.
If you feel unwell or are having serious difficultly, move into this lane to seek attention.
There will be nine hydration stations along the 10km race course, and four on the 5km route.
Brisbane Run Squad founder Mark Turner said the elite runners might not use the drink stations, but it was good for others to take a break and grab a drink. Good preparation was important, too.
“In the days leading up to the race, drink 5-8 glasses a day with meals as that improves absorption,” he said. “On the day, have a light breakfast and a couple of glasses of water.”
He said not to try anything new on the day. Don’t wear new shoes, try a new breakfast or push yourself hard if you don’t normally. “Just enjoy the day – it’s a great community event.”
